## TL;DR
- OpEx and service charge typically add 20–35% to base rent.
- Cleaning, security, MEP maintenance, and lobby concierge are the largest line items.
- Pass-through structures vary materially by region — translate via the Lease Term Translator.
- Always negotiate caps on controllable OpEx in the LOI.

## FAQ
### What's a typical OpEx load in Copenhagen?
20–35% of base rent for institutional Class A. Premium buildings with concierge, gym, and amenity programming sit at the top of that range.
